qa/308 - accommodate Fedora 18 and proc PMDA changes
In Fedora 18, the process with pid 1 is not "init" but
/usr/lib/systemd/systemd (with some complicated arguments).
Also the PMID we're filtering has probably been wrong since the
proc metrics were split into a separate PMDA.
Only started to fail when a couple of QA hosts had the proc PMDA
installed by default, and this moved from a "notrun" to "failing
most places" state.
